The condition was I signed a contract for two years with the company. Just asked my boss and he sorted it out for me. If I leave within 2 years I have to pay a certain amount back, but in the long run I know I have job now for two more years.

Even though I do multi drop at the moment in a 18t, I enjoy working at the company so that’s why I signed it :slight_smile:

Also passed my class one today as well :slight_smile: so buzzing today haha
